Totally Smashed is a condition that can affect players. It is the worst state of intoxication for a character beyond drunk.
Continuing to drink strong beverages after becoming Totally Smashed can make a player vomit.
Gameplay effects[]
Getting a character totally smashed lowers the visual level of an NPC enemy as it appears to the drunken player and presumably worse than just "drunk".
While the true level of the creature remains the same, it appears lowered to the character who is drunk. The apparent level of a mob goes down by up to 5 levels while "completely smashed", and slowly returns to its actual level while slowly sobering up. The player still receives the same XP for killing mobs as they would while sober. Note that this effect can and will corrupt data collected with addons such as MobInfo2.
Movement is also impaired similarly to being just drunk but generally worse in all ways.
Also, if the player's character consumes too much alcohol, then the spell "[Drunken Vomit]" is cast, causing the character to pause and vomit.
Graphics effects[]
For supported graphics cards, your screen will blur around the edges until it becomes nearly impossible to see clearly.
